I can't say that we ever really shopped around. When I went off my parent's car insurance policy back when I was 22, I stayed with the same agent (who is affiliated with State Farm). Since then, I've added policies with them for everything else and added my wife to the policy after we got married. My parents still have their slate of policies with them as well.

I've had zero complaints. Competitive rates and really no dickishness when you make a claim or get a traffic infraction. And I feel I can call up the agent and get his advice when dealing with claims through other companies, etc.

Of course, this could all be a function of my family having a bunch of policies with this same agent for well over 30 years and not a function of the insurance company he is an agent for.

Body shops I've dealt with have shared complaints about how State Farm handles estimates and supplementals. But this hasn't impacted me directly.
